对未知大小的小部件进行动画扩展/收缩是一种常见的交互效果,可以通过动画的方式改变小部件的尺寸,使其在用户界面中展开或收起。这种效果可以提升用户体验,使界面更加生动和易于操作。
在前端开发中,可以使用CSS的transition或animation属性来实现动画效果。通过设置合适的过渡时间和过渡函数,可以使小部件平滑地扩展或收缩。
在后端开发中,可以通过服务器端的响应来控制小部件的扩展或收缩。例如,当用户点击展开按钮时,服务器可以返回相应的数据,前端根据返回的数据进行动画效果的展示。
在移动开发中,可以使用各种移动应用开发框架(如React Native、Flutter等)提供的动画组件来实现小部件的扩展/收缩效果。
在应用场景方面,对未知大小的小部件进行动画扩展/收缩常用于折叠菜单、展开/收起面板、显示/隐藏内容等交互场景。例如,在一个网页中,可以使用动画效果来展开/收起一个折叠菜单,以提供更多的选项给用户。
腾讯云提供了丰富的云计算产品,其中与动画效果相关的产品包括:
总结:对未知大小的小部件进行动画扩展/收缩是一种常见的交互效果,可以通过前端开发、后端开发、移动开发等方式实现。腾讯云提供了多种相关产品和服务,可用于支持开发和部署这种效果。
领取专属 10元无门槛券
手把手带您无忧上云